Annual variations in the plasma thyroxine level in Microcebus murinus
General and Comparative Endocrinology
|September 1, 1984
Abstract:
There is a great annual variation of plasma thyroxine (T4) in Microcebus murinus. The averages range between 30 and 68 ng/ml from February to July, and fall to 6 ng/ml in November. Long photoperiods seem to be the environmental factor responsible for the summer increase in plasma T4 as they are for testosterone. There is no apparent phase opposition with annual testosterone variation.
